Water Extraction
We use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to get the water out as fast as possible. This step is critical because the longer water sits, the more damage it can do. We work to remove standing water and moisture from floors, cabinets, and walls. It’s not just about what you can see. We go where the water hides. We do this in under an hour so you don’t have to wait too long. We make sure the area is dry and safe before moving on.
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is gone, we set up industrial dryers and dehumidifiers. These machines pull moisture from the air and materials. We monitor the area closely to make sure everything dries properly. This step can take 2-3 days depending on the size of the job. We check regularly to keep things on track. Drying is just as important as removing the water. We do it right the first time.

Kitchen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small puddle on the floor | Yes | No | It’s easy to clean but not the best way to prevent mold |
| Water under cabinets | No | Yes | Hidden water can cause major damage if not handled right |
| Leaky sink or faucet | Yes | No | Fix it fast to stop more water from building up |
| Water from a broken pipe | No | Yes | It can flood the whole kitchen if not stopped quickly |
| Standing water over 2 inches deep | No | Yes | It’s too much for a quick fix and can cause serious damage |
| Water in walls or under floors | No | Yes | It’s not visible but can lead to mold and rot |

Kitchen Water Removal Cost In Wake Forest, NC
Kitchen water removal costs vary depending on the size of the job, how fast we can act, and what kind of damage is done. You don’t want to guess, we give you a clear idea of what to expect. These are general ranges for the services you might need. Your situation is unique, so we’ll give you a free estimate and talk through your options. You get honest pricing and real help.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, location, and time to act |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$4,000 | Size of area, humidity levels, and materials used |
| Sanitization and cleaning | $300 – $1,200 | Extent of damage and type of surfaces |
| Structural repairs | $1,500 – $6,000 | Damage to walls, floors, or cabinets |
| Mold remediation | $2,000 – $8,000 | Size of infestation and access to affected areas |
| Final inspection and restoration |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of work and materials needed |

What equipment do you use for kitchen water removal?
We use industrial-grade pumps, wet vacuums, and dehumidifiers to get the job done right. These tools help remove water quickly and dry out the area. We also use air movers and moisture meters to check for hidden moisture. You get the best equipment to make sure your kitchen is safe and dry. We do the job right the first time.
